The WPO has quickly established itself as one of the most successful poker tournaments in the world and is attended by both nationally and internationally renowned poker players. This Tunica Poker Tournament is one of the 13 televised World Poker Tour tournaments held every year in a no-limit, Texas Hold’Em tournament.

WPO Winner WPO Championship No Limit Hold'em Event ( WPT) Final
Thu, Jan 27 2005 at 12:00 PM
John Stolzmann from Madison, WI won the Championship event at the 6th Annual Jack Binion World Poker Open. John had to beat what may have been the toughest ever WPT final table that included Daniel Negreanu, Scotty Nguyen and Chau Giang. John, a 23 year old Law Student took home $1,465,944 and the title of WPO Champion 2005.

WPO Winner WPO Event # 18 Ladies No Limit Hold'em
Sun, Jan 23 2005 at 12:00 PM
Angel Word from Bowdon, GA won event #18 ($200 buyin Ladies No Limit Holdem) late last night at the 6th Annual Jack Binion World Poker Open. The event attracted a record field of 433 players. Angela took home $25,261 and a beautiful gold and diamond WPO bracelet.

WPO Winner WPO Event # 17 No Limit Texas Hold'em
Sat, Jan 22 2005 at 12:00 PM
Jess Yawitz from St.Louis won event 17 tonight ($3,000 buyin No Limit Holdem) at the 6th Annual Jack Binion World Poker Open in Tunica, MS. Jess, who has only been playing for 8 months took home $334,701 and a coveted diamond and gold WPO bracelet.

WPO Winner WPO Event # 12 Pot Limit Omaha
Mon, Jan 17 2005 at 12:00 PM
6th Annual Jack Binion World Poker Open, Goldstrike and Horseshoe Casinos, Tunica MS. Event 12 tonight ($1,000 buyin Pot Limit Omaha with rebuys) was won by Mads Andersen from Denmark. After the most exciting final table so far, Mads finally took down Robert Williamson III to take home $118,379 and his first WPO gold bracelet.

WPO Winner WPO Event #8 Omaha Hi/Lo Split
Thu, Jan 13 2005 at 12:00 PM
Sirous Baghchehsaraie made WPO history tonight when he came back from an 85 to 1 chip deficit heads up to beat Gary Jones to win event #8 ($500 buyin Omaha Hi/Lo)and take home his first WPO bracelet and $64,467.
